在ListView中突出显示整行是指在列表中的某一行上应用特殊的样式或效果,以使该行在视觉上与其他行有所区别,从而突出显示。
实现在ListView中突出显示整行的方法有多种,以下是其中几种常见的方式:
- 使用Selector:可以通过在ListView的适配器中为每一行设置不同的背景选择器(Selector),当某一行被选中时,背景选择器会改变该行的背景颜色或其他样式,从而突出显示整行。具体实现可参考腾讯云的产品介绍链接地址:Selector。
- 自定义布局:可以自定义ListView的每一行布局,在布局文件中设置特定的样式或效果,例如设置背景颜色、边框、字体颜色等,以突出显示整行。具体实现可参考腾讯云的产品介绍链接地址:自定义布局。
- 使用第三方库:还可以使用一些开源的第三方库来实现在ListView中突出显示整行的效果,例如通过使用RecyclerView和CardView组合来实现列表项的卡片式显示,或使用其他UI库提供的特定样式来突出显示整行。具体实现可参考腾讯云的产品介绍链接地址:第三方库。
在实际应用中,突出显示整行的场景很多,例如在聊天应用中,可以通过突出显示最新的消息行来吸引用户注意;在商品列表中,可以通过突出显示特价商品行来吸引用户购买等。
总结起来,实现在ListView中突出显示整行的方法有多种,可以通过使用Selector、自定义布局或第三方库来实现。具体选择哪种方法取决于具体的需求和开发环境。